telfordtodd Posted October 4 Share Posted October 4 My issue is when i switch channels, there is a distinct delay or "blip" in the sound. Really is a drag when trying to switch from a clean tone to a crunch or high gain and there is a 1/2 second drop in the sound before the other channel kicks in. DO you guys have that issue as well? You are not switching analog channels, you are switching PRESETS. It takes time to UNLOAD one preset from memory, then load another into memory. It's nowhere near 1/2 second, MAYBE 100ms, if that. More like 30-50ms. You either learn to work around it (don't switch presets with a note ringing, pause for a dotted 1/8th) or find a product that doesn't do that. I don't know of one. The BOSS GT1000 is designed to work like that, but the Katana does not (AFAIK) contain that technology.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
